Bruce Allan Schultz (24 May 1932 – 27 July 2012) was the eighth Bishop of Grafton in the Anglican Church of Australia.

Schultz was educated at Culcairn High School, St Columb’s Hall and St John’s College, Morpeth. He was briefly a sheep farmer before beginning his ordained ministry as a curate at Broken Hill. After this he was priest in charge at Ardlethan and then the Archdeacon of Rockhampton and Dean of Christ Church Cathedral, Grafton.

Schultz died in Buderim Views in 2012. He was the husband of Janet and the father of Anne, Peter, Leigh and Luke. He was also the loving grandfather of Tadhg, Alex, Amy, Eamon, Xanthe and Matthew.
